DJ Super Micro Computer Inc. Stock Outperforms Competitors Despite Losses On The Day
This article was automatically generated by MarketWatch using technology from Automated Insights.
Shares of Super Micro Computer Inc. $(SMCI)$ shed 2.18% to $32.79 Tuesday, on what proved to be an all-around mixed trading session for the stock market, with the Dow Jones Industrial Average rising 0.11% to 49,760.56 and the S&P 500 Index falling 0.16% to 7,400.96.
This was the stock's second consecutive day of losses.
Super Micro Computer Inc. closed 47.42% below its 52-week high of $62.36, which the company reached on July 31st.
The stock demonstrated a mixed performance when compared to some of its competitors Tuesday, as HP Inc. $(HPQ)$ fell 2.72% to $21.08, Intel Corp. $(INTC)$ fell 6.82% to $120.61, and Digi International Inc. $(DGII)$ fell 2.02% to $61.53.
Trading volume (35.0 M) remained 5.1 million below its 50-day average volume of 40.2 M.
